1. Clinical Psychologist: As a clinical psychologist, you will work with individuals to diagnose and treat various mental health disorders. You will conduct assessments, provide therapy, and develop treatment plans to help clients improve their well-being.
2. Counseling Psychologist: Counseling psychologists focus on helping individuals cope with everyday challenges and improve their mental health. You will provide therapy, support, and guidance to clients in a variety of settings, such as schools, hospitals, and private practices.
3. Research Psychologist: If you have a passion for research, a career as a research psychologist may be perfect for you. You will conduct studies, analyze data, and contribute to the advancement of psychological knowledge in areas such as cognitive psychology, social psychology, and developmental psychology.
4. Forensic Psychologist: Forensic psychologists work within the criminal justice system to assess and treat individuals involved in legal matters. You may work with law enforcement agencies, courts, and correctional facilities to provide expert testimony, evaluate offenders, and develop intervention programs.
5. Educational Psychologist: Educational psychologists focus on understanding how people learn and develop within educational settings. You will work with students, teachers, and parents to address learning difficulties, behavioral issues, and emotional challenges that may impact academic performance.
